Product Overview: The NJ 410 Cylindrical Roller Bearing
The NJ 410 is a high-capacity, single-row cylindrical roller bearing designed for heavy-duty industrial applications. With dimensions of 50x130x31mm (Bore x Outer Diameter x Thickness), this bearing is a key component in our NJ 400 Series of Cylindrical Roller Bearings. The 'NJ' designation signifies a specific flange configuration: the inner ring features two integral flanges, while the outer ring has one. This design allows the bearing to accommodate not only high radial loads but also light axial loads in a single direction, effectively locating the shaft in one position.

Its separable design, where the outer ring can be mounted independently of the inner ring and roller assembly, simplifies both installation and maintenance procedures. Key Features of the NJ 410 Bearing
- High Radial Load Capacity: Engineered with line contact between the rollers and raceways to support substantial radial forces.
- Single-Direction Axial Location: The flange arrangement allows the bearing to guide the shaft axially in one direction.
- Separable Design: The inner ring with its roller and cage assembly can be mounted separately from the outer ring, facilitating easier installation and inspection.
- High-Speed Performance: Optimized geometry and precision manufacturing enable reliable operation at high rotational speeds.
- Robust Construction: Made from high-quality bearing steel for superior durability and resistance to wear and fatigue.
- High Stiffness: Provides excellent rigidity, which is crucial for applications requiring precise shaft alignment and minimal deflection.
